Regulates residential mental health treatment facilities.
This bill establishes new licensing and operational standards for residential mental health treatment facilities in New Jersey. It requires these facilities to provide comprehensive 24/7 care consistent with medical guidelines, prohibits retrospective medical necessity reviews, and mandates licensing from the Commissioner of Health. The bill directly affects facilities offering residential mental health care (excluding hospital-based programs or substance use facilities) and the patients they serve. Key provisions include mandatory licensing, location restrictions (banning co-location with substance use facilities), and requiring the commissioner to adopt minimum care standards within 90 days.
